Constitution can be changed through Parliament'

By Ananda Kannangara.

The prorogation of the Parliament by President Chandrika Bandaranaike Kumaratunga was undemocratic at a time when a No Confidence Motion was before the Speaker with the signatures of all 115 members in the Opposition. It is the duty of the President to reconvene the Parliament without holding a Referendum, Opposition Leader Ranil Wickremesinghe said on Wednesday.
